1 /********************************************************************** 2 Freeciv - Copyright (C) 1996 - A Kjeldberg, L Gregersen, P Unold 3 This program is free software; you can redistribute it and/or modify 4 it under the terms of the GNU General Public License as published by 5 the Free Software Foundation; either version 2, or (at your option) 6 any later version. 7 8 This program is distributed in the hope that it will be useful, 9 but WITHOUT ANY WARRANTY; without even the implied warranty of 10 M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the 11 GNU General Public License for more details. 12 ***********************************************************************/ 13 #ifndef FC__DIALOGS_H 14 #define FC__DIALOGS_H 15 16 #include <X11/Intrinsic.h> 17 18 #include "dialogs_g.h" 19 20 void popup_revolution_dialog(struct government *pgovernment); 21 Widget popup_message_dialog(Widget parent, const char *shellname, 22 const char *text, ...); 23 void destroy_message_dialog(Widget button); 24 25 void popup_about_dialog(void); 26 void racesdlg_key_ok(Widget w); 27 28 enum help_type_dialog {HELP_COPYING_DIALOG, HELP_KEYS_DIALOG}; 29 30 void free_bitmap_destroy_callback(Widget w, XtPointer client_data, 31 XtPointer call_data); 32 void destroy_me_callback(Widget w, XtPointer client_data, 33 XtPointer call_data); 34 35 void taxrates_callback(Widget w, XtPointer client_data, XtPointer call_data); 36 37 #endif /* FC__DIALOGS_H */ 38